It’s official. As we discussed last week, Josh Rodriguez is now a Cleveland Indian once again. Rodriguez will be tearing it up for their Columbus team in AAA.
In December, the Pirates wrote a $50,000 check to Cleveland to make Rodriguez the first overall pick in the Rule 5 Draft. He had one hit in 12 at-bats with the Bucs, a dribbled infield single. In AAA last season, Rodriguez showed some pop with 12 bombs and 23 doubles in 86 games with the Clippers.
The Tribe paid the Pirates $25,000 to get him back on the roster.
